The grand old party has also fielded Varun Chaudhary from Ambala, Divyanshu Budhiraja from Karnal, Satpal Brahmachari from Sonipat, Rao Dhan Singh from Bhiwani Mahendragarh and Jai Prakash from Hisar, as per the latest list.
BJP turncoat , who joined Congress along with his father Bijender Singh, had been eying the Hisar seat.
Elections for 10 Lok Sabha seats in Haryana will be held in the sixth phase of elections on May 25. The BJP won all ten states from the state in 2019 elections.

The Congress is contesting two Lok Sabha seats in Mumbai this time in accordance with the seat-sharing formula in the opposition (MVA) . The other seat that the grand old party will contest is Mumbai North. Polling in Mumbai will be held on May 20.
The names were released a day before the Phase 2 of Lok Sabha Elections being held across 88 seats today, April 26. With the April 25 list, the Congress has so far fielded 317 candidates across the country.
The seven-phase Lok Sabha Elections will end on June 1. Counting will take place on June 4.
